Why La Trains PUA Encoding Matters for Small Business Designers

One technical detail that significantly impacts workflow efficiency is encoding. La Trains is PUA encoded which mean users can access special characters, ligatures, and alternates easily through standard keyboard shortcuts or character maps in design software. For a small business owner who might not be a full-time graphic designer, this feature is a game-changer. It means you are not limited to basic letters. You can add flourishes, connect specific letter pairs smoothly, or insert decorative symbols that give your branding a custom, bespoke look.

This level of customization is crucial for creating consistent brand identity across different platforms. Whether you are designing a thank-you card to include in shipment boxes or creating a digital sticker for social media, having access to these extra glyphs allows for variation without changing the core font. It prevents your designs from looking repetitive and helps maintain that high-end feel. The ability to tweak the handwriting style slightly for different contexts ensures that your Script Handwritten elements remain fresh and engaging, rather than static and robotic.

Pairing La Trains with Clean Typography for Maximum Impact

To get the most out of this Script Handwritten font, pairing it with the right secondary typeface is essential. Because La Trains has a distinct personality and flowing lines, it pairs beautifully with clean, modern sans-serif fonts. This contrast ensures that while the headline grabs attention with its artistic flair, the supporting information remains easy to read. For example, on a café menu, you might use La Trains for the section headers like "Pastries" or "Specialty Drinks," while using a simple geometric sans-serif for the descriptions and prices.

Avoid pairing it with other complex scripts or overly decorative serif fonts, as this can create visual noise and reduce readability. The goal is to let La Trains shine as the star of the show. Think of it as the jewelry in an outfit; it should accentuate, not overwhelm. By keeping the rest of your design minimal and structured, you allow the stunning impact of the handwritten elements to guide the viewer’s eye naturally through your content. This approach works for business cards, flyers, and even email newsletters, ensuring a professional and polished presentation.
